🌿 The Power Behind the Leaves

The leaves of guava (Psidium guajava) are rich in flavonoids and vitamin C, known for their ability to reduce oxidative stress and support gut health. Soursop leaves (Annona muricata) have been traditionally used in tropical regions for their calming effects and potential to aid digestion. Mango leaves (Mangifera indica) contain mangiferin, a potent antioxidant that helps protect cells from damage. When combined with turmeric’s curcumin—a powerful anti-inflammatory compound—this infusion creates a synergistic blend that may help maintain a balanced internal environment.

Key takeaway: Each leaf contributes unique bioactive compounds that work together to support your body’s natural defenses and digestive processes. Regular consumption, as part of a balanced lifestyle, may help you feel more energetic and resilient.

✅ Ingredients You’ll Need

  • 4 fresh guava leaves – thoroughly washed and chopped into small pieces
  • 4 soursop leaves – cleaned and roughly chopped
  • 4 mango leaves – rinsed and chopped (choose young, tender leaves if possible)
  • ½ liter of water – preferably filtered or spring water
  • ½ teaspoon of turmeric powder – or a small piece of fresh turmeric root, grated

Make sure all leaves are free from pesticides. If you cannot find fresh leaves, dried leaves (reduced quantity by half) can be used, but fresh ones usually yield a more aromatic and potent infusion.

📝 Step-by-Step Preparation

Follow these simple steps to create your herbal tea:

  1. Prepare the leaves: Wash each leaf carefully under running water, then cut them into small pieces to maximize surface area for extraction.
  2. Boil the water: Pour the ½ liter of water into a medium saucepan and bring it to a gentle boil.
  3. Add the leaves and turmeric: Place the chopped guava, soursop, and mango leaves into the boiling water, then sprinkle in the turmeric powder.
  4. Simmer for 15 minutes: Reduce the heat to medium and let the mixture simmer uncovered. Stir occasionally to ensure even extraction.
  5. Strain and serve: After 15 minutes, turn off the heat, allow the infusion to cool slightly, then strain it through a fine mesh or cheesecloth into a cup. Enjoy it warm.

Pro tip: To enhance the flavor, you can add a teaspoon of raw honey or a squeeze of lemon once the tea has cooled a bit. Avoid adding sweeteners if you are monitoring your sugar intake.

⚠️ Important Safety Information

While natural, this infusion is not a substitute for medical treatment. Please read the following points carefully:

  • This tea does NOT cure or treat cancer, diabetes, high blood pressure, or circulatory problems. It is a supportive beverage, not a medication.
  • Always consult your healthcare provider before starting any herbal remedy, especially if you have a chronic condition or are pregnant, nursing, or planning surgery.
  • If you take prescription drugs, check for possible interactions. For example, turmeric can affect blood clotting and blood sugar levels, so people on anticoagulants or diabetes medications should exercise caution.
  • Stop consumption immediately if you experience any allergic reactions (itching, rash, swelling) or digestive discomfort.
